Personal Details & Bio Data

Full NameVirginia Wynette Pugh
BornMay 5, 1942
BirthplaceTremont, Mississippi, United States
DiedApril 6, 1998 (aged 55)
SpousesEuple Byrd, Don Chapel, George Jones, Michael Tomlin, George Richey
ChildrenGwen, Jacquelyn, Tina, Tamala
OccupationSinger, Songwriter
Years Active1966–1998

The Later Marriages - How Did Other Tammy Wynette Spouses Fit In?

After her very public split from George Jones, Tammy Wynette continued to search for lasting companionship. She married a few more times, each relationship bringing its own set of experiences to her life. There was Michael Tomlin, a brief marriage that, in a way, happened pretty quickly. This partnership was, basically, a short chapter in her long story, showing her continued hope for finding a stable partner. It seemed that, even with all her fame, the desire for a simple, loving home life was, you know, still very much at the forefront of her personal wishes.

Her final marriage was to George Richey, who was also her manager. This relationship was, in some respects, her longest, lasting until her passing. Richey was a constant presence in her later life, both personally and professionally. He was by her side through many of her health challenges and continued to support her career. This partnership offered a different kind of stability, one that was, perhaps, more about companionship and shared goals in her later years. The role of George Richey as a Tammy Wynette spouse was, well, pretty significant in her final decades, providing a steady hand amidst her health struggles and continued touring.
